Most people go through life and feel unnoticed. We are all afraid to be vulnerable, and let our true feelings show for the ones we care about. The movie To All the Boys I’ve Loved Before is popular because of how it is relatable. High school may be the most challenging part of a person's life. In the movie, Lara Jean is afraid to love because that person can easily leave and hurt her. Although Lara Jean is holding herself back, she is noticed by many which she learns throughout the movie. This is why To All the Boys I’ve Loved Before connected to the feelings of people worldwide. In reality, we are all noticed someway by many people around us.
